What the Fine Print Actually Says

  • Bonus must be claimed within 24 hours of registration – a ticking clock that scares you into hasty decisions.
  • Wagering requirement of 30x the bonus amount – a figure that turns a £10 bonus into a £300 play budget.
  • Only certain slots count towards the wager – usually the low‑variance titles that chew up your bet slowly.
  • Maximum cash‑out limit of £50 – the ceiling on any potential win from the bonus.
  • Withdrawal requests must be verified with additional ID – a process that can stretch a few days into weeks.

Because the casino wants to ensure you can’t simply cash out the bonus before the house has a chance to reclaim its percentage. The verification step, while ostensibly a security measure, also serves as a comforting delay for the operator.
